The Fan Energy Index (FEI), developed by the Air Movement and Control Association International (AMCA), helps design professionals select the most energy-efficient fan to serve the required pressure and flow for each building. In addition to reducing energy costs, more efficient fans are also quieter and more reliable. Join our expert to learn how the FEI can work for you.
ATTENDEES WILL LEARN HOW TO:
-Identify the factors that affect a fan’s FEI rating.
-Incorporate FEI into the fan specification and selection process.
-Apply FEI in variable air volume (VAV) and constant-speed air systems.
-Utilize FEI to be compliant with upcoming Illinois code updates (ASHRAE 90.1-2019 and IECC-2021).
